Overview
- ESPN cameras showed Lowe celebrating Shohei Ohtani’s leadoff home run at Dodger Stadium on Tuesday night.
- The actor, who grew up in the Dayton area, has long been publicly identified with Cincinnati’s fan base.
- Social media posts and blog coverage criticized him as a fake or bandwagon supporter after the broadcast.
- WLWT reported he has been seen rooting for the Dodgers in previous playoff games as a California resident.
- Some outlets said he wore a Dodgers World Series commemorative hat at the game, a detail not confirmed by Lowe.
